Mercy St Vincent Medical CenterMercy St Vincent Medical Center is an ACGME-accredited Pediatrics residency program in Toledo, OH. It has 4 PGY-1 positions per year and approximately 12 residents in training. It reports 81.8% IMG residents, J-1 and H-1B visa sponsorship, and a PGY-1 salary of $65,444. - Does Mercy St Vincent Medical Center sponsor J-1 or H-1B visas?
- Yes — Mercy St Vincent Medical Center reports sponsoring both J-1 and H-1B visas. Sponsorship is set by the program and its sponsoring institution and can change between cycles, so confirm with the program before you apply.

- What is the resident salary at Mercy St Vincent Medical Center?
- Mercy St Vincent Medical Center reports a PGY-1 salary of $65,444. Salary is set by the sponsoring institution and rises each training year through completion.
